Pogba tests positive for Covid-19, according to his manager

Manchester United player was not in the France national team squad on Thursday

Manchester United midfielder Paul Pogba has tested positive for Covid-19, according to France manager Didier Deschamps.

The 27-year-old was not in the France national team squad announced on Thursday for the upcoming Nations League double-header against Sweden and Croatia.

Pogba was due to be called up but has been replaced by 17-year-old Rennes midfielder Eduardo Camavinga.

Deschamps told a press conference: “I’ve completed at the very last minute a change in the list, because Paul Pogba, who was previously on the list, unfortunately for him he carried out a test yesterday which was returned as positive this morning.

“So at the last moment he had to be replaced by Eduardo Camavinga.”
